How much is the nursing program at UTA?
$8,995
UTA is a public, nonprofit university. As of October 2018, the tuition for nursing courses in the RN to BSN program totals $8,995. General education courses, if necessary, are at an additional per credit hour tuition rate of $362, or $1086 per 3-hour course.
How do I get into UT Arlington nursing program?
Thirty (30) or more required College of Nursing prerequisite lower division credit hours earned at UT Arlington….Completion of designated sections of the TEst of Essential Academic Skills (TEAS) with the folloiwng minimum scores;
- Reading: 70%
- Math: 70%
- Science: 70%
- English and Language Usages: 70%
How long is UTA nursing program?
About the BSN Program The 51 credit-hour online BSN program is designed to be completed in as few as 15 months. Individual courses in the program vary in length from 5 to 14 weeks. Once accepted into the program, students must complete the required courses in the exact sequence prescribed by the College of Nursing.

How many nursing students are at UTA?
Across all nursing programs, enrollment grew from 6,300 to over 25,000 students, quadrupling in just that short time. BSN enrollment increased by over 5,000 students, MSN by nearly 6,000, and RN to BSN by over 8,000. Much of this growth is attributed to the addition of accelerated online programs in the College.
How long is UTA accelerated nursing?
15 months
The University of Texas at Arlington has launched its first accelerated campus-based Bachelor of Science in Nursing program, which allows students to finish their last two years of nursing school in 15 months. The first cohort in the College of Nursing and Health Innovation (CONHI) began earlier this year.
Is the University of Texas at Arlington’s nursing program accredited?
The baccalaureate degree program in nursing, master’s degree program in nursing, Doctor of Nursing Practice program and post-graduate APRN certificate program at The University of Texas at Arlington are accredited by the Commission on Collegiate Nursing Education, 655 K Street, NW, Suite 750, Washington, DC 20001, 202-887-6791.

Is the School of Nursing at Arkansas State University accredited?
The School of Nursing at Arkansas State University is approved by the Arkansas State Board of Nursing. The Associate, Baccalaureate, and Master’s/Post-Master’s Certificate nursing programs at Arkansas State University located in Jonesboro, Arkansas are accredited by the Accreditation Commission for Education in Nursing (ACEN).
